Brownie by 孟兆庆

Ingredients:

unsalted butter 125g
sugar 80g
cocoa powder 30g
2 eggs
cake flour 145g
baking powder 1/2 tsp
baking soda 1/4tsp
1/2 cup of milk
chocolate chips 100g
walnuts, chopped 50g (I added in myself)

Method:
1. Melt the butter and sugar over boiling water.
2. Add in the cocoa powder while it (1) is still hot.
3. Cool the mixture then add in the eggs one by one.
4. Sieve in half the flour and pour in half the milk.
5. Stir till no flour is seen then add in the rest of the flour and milk.
6. Stir in mix direction till no flour is visible. Mix in the chocolate chips and chopped walnuts.
7. Pour into a square mould (forgot what is the size, should be 7 in by 7 in) and bake at 180oC for 15 minutes.


This brownie is great be it warm or chilled. Worth trying. It doesn't take long to prepare. Enjoy!
